About
Overview
Located in Denver's RiNo Art District, Studios on Blake offers dedicated, affordable workspace for working artists within the Backyard on Blake creative campus. These private studios support and sustain artists in one of the city's fastest-evolving cultural districts, ensuring creative production remains central to RiNo's identity. A limited number of subsidized studios are available through support from the RiNo Business Improvement District (BID).
Studio Features
Each studio features high ceilings, natural light, and the character of RiNo's industrial architecture. Studios on Blake is best suited for painters, illustrators, and mixed-media artists seeking clean, professional workspace. Due to building limitations, studios are not equipped for heavy fabrication or processes requiring specialized ventilation or equipment.
Amenities
- 24-hour access and dedicated WiFi
- Heating, A/C, and all utilities included
- Shared kitchen (fridge/microwave), utility sink, and garbage/recycling dumpsters
- Community events and networking through RiNo Art District, including First Friday Open Houses
- Parking available in adjacent lot via Parkwell (paid) or free street parking around Backyard on Blake
Lease Terms
- Size: Approximately 200 sq. ft.
- Rent: $650/month + $650 security deposit
- Payment: Check or online tenant portal
- Terms: Month-to-month with 30 days' notice
- Insurance: Tenants must carry liability insurance (details in lease contract)
Community Engagement
While primarily a working studio environment, Studios on Blake plays a role in connecting artists with the broader community. The studios periodically open to the public during district-wide events like First Fridays, offering opportunities for visitors to engage directly with artists and experience work in progress. Participation in community events is encouraged but not required.
